Carderock Division, Naval Surface Warfare Center West Bethesda, MD 20817-5700, USA In this study, a variety of additives have been evaluated as potential fire retardants for polyureas with cone calorimetry being the method of evaluation. The additives that have been evaluated include minerals (alumina trihydrate), bromine-, nitrogen-, and phosphorus-based fire retardants. The major criteria for evaluation are the reductions in the peak heat release rate and the total heat released, the evolution of smoke and dripping.
